Dáil Éireann - Volume 265 - 16 May, 1973 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Commercial Banks Pay Proposals. Mr. Brennan Mr. Brennan 53. Mr. Brennan: asked the Minister for Labour (a) if the commercial banks are implementing all the proposals on pay and conditions of employment recently negotiated by the IBOA and (b) the extent to which the terms of this agreement are incompatible with the current national pay agreement. Minister for Labour (Mr. M. O'Leary) Michael O'Leary Minister for Labour (Mr. M. O'Leary): The Banks' Staff Relations Committee have informed me that the proposals in question were implemented at the end of February last. With regard to the second part of the Deputy's question, I would refer him to the Labour Court report which was published on the 21st April. Mr. Brennan Mr. Brennan Mr. Brennan: Does the Minister propose taking any retrospective action? Mr. M. O'Leary Mr. M. O'Leary Mr. M. O'Leary: The matter is having my closest attention.
